Kelly Review launched following the unprecedented power supply failure caused by the major fire at National Grid and SSEN’s North Hyde substation, which impacted a large area of West London and Heathrow’s operations on 21st March.

Heathrow Chairman Lord Paul Deighton said: “Closing the airport had significant impacts for our passengers, our customers, our colleagues and the country. Heathrow regrets the disruption this caused. We hope that all those affected understand that the decision was made in order to prioritise the safety of our passengers and colleagues. We are committed to finding any potential learnings from this unprecedented incident.

“To fully understand what happened, I have asked Ruth Kelly, former Secretary of State for Transport and an independent member of Heathrow’s Board, to undertake a review. The Kelly Review will analyse all of the relevant material concerning the robustness and execution of Heathrow’s crisis management plans, the airport’s response during the incident and how the airport recovered the operation with the objective of identifying any improvements that could be made to our future resilience.”
